It is a new 3D embossing folder and stencil from the new just released collection
In My Heart from Simon Says Stamp. This is the Butterfly Escapade, it also
comes with a die which I didn't use this time as I didn't want to cover any
of the pretty embossed pieces up anymore then I did with the sentiment.
The folder/stencil set is out of stock but you can buy each set separately so far.
The inks I used are all Altenew Rubellite~Hydrangea~Shadow Creek and
Grass Field. The sentiment stamp and die is Hero Arts Ribbon Messages.
